I stayed at Harrah's from August 19th to August 21st for the first two nights of my vacation. I had a comp offer to stay either here, Imperial Palace, or Rio but decided to stay here since the other two were already booked with the offer.

Room

The room was in the Mardi Gras tower, which is closer to the Strip and a quick walk away. It also overlooked the Mirage volcano pit (too bad it was under construction). I had an issue with the air conditioning because it would turn off if no motion was detected. This was especially annoying when trying to get a good night sleep and hearing a loud fan going on and off every 20 minutes. The sign in the room said that Harrah's was trying to be "green", but it is not efficient to keep turning the AC on and off. I can understand while you are out of the room in the daytime but not while trying to sleep.

Amenities

The pool is rather small and it was challenging to get a seat. It seemed like they had too many VIP seats that required an extra charge. The free shuttle to the Rio is a major plus. Good times were had at the Carnaval Court. The Total Rewards card is one of the best in the business and is valid at many casinos across the country. Very helpful staff.

Overall

The location is great and I would consider staying again if I had a comp. Stay here if you are looking for a reasonably priced room that is close to everything. They should do something about the AC in the room, though.

I stayed at Harrah's in June 2008 for five nights. The hispanic hotel desk clerk was excellent. She gave me a choice of rooms. A room with a view and possible noise from a live band or a room in the back with no view but quiet. I choose the room with no view.

It was very nice and updated. BUT...It was HOT. Whenever I left the room the A/C automatically shut OFF. It was 107 degrees one day. I came back to the room and the temp. was 80 degrees. It took until 6 am for the room to cool off before the temp reached 70 degrees. Sleep was next to impossible.

I spent about 1000$ at the slots in Harrahs. I didnt even get play money. The drink service was excellent though.

The buffet was ok. But nothing special. The sandwich shop near the poker room is pretty good and filling.
